God Pays for whatever HE Orders

He said, Blessed be the Lord, the God of Israel, Who spoke with His mouth to David my father and has with His hand fulfilled it…”1Kings 8:15
The summation of Solomon in the above scriptures is that God always accomplished whatsoever HE has spoken to be done. 
He never gives you an assignment that He will not show you how to do it and give you the means to do it.  
When He told Mosses He would use him to deliver the children of Israel out of bondage God showed up all the way in helping Him to accomplish that task. 
What has God spoken to you to do ?
Relax and listen to Him because certainly He will accomplish what He has asked you to do. 
The Testimony of Solomon above about God’s assignments for David his father was that God’s hands literally carried out all what He told him to do. 
David faced so many challenges but he never lost track of God. 
He made mistakes along the way but he knew God will never leave him nor forsake Him. 
“Blessed be the Lord, Who has given rest to His people Israel, according to all that He promised. 
Not one word has failed of all His good promise which He promised through Moses His servant”1Kings 8:56
Be encouraged today that God will certainly do whatever he has promised you. 
Once you are sure it’s God that ordered what  you are doing you can be sure His mighty hands will accomplish it.
